Which companies in Kansas sponsor visas for technical lead roles?
Spirit AeroSystems, Garmin, and Cerner (now Oracle Health) are among the Kansas employers with documented H-1B sponsorship activity for senior technical roles. Garmin's Olathe headquarters and Cerner's Kansas City-area operations have historically filed for technical leads in software engineering and systems architecture. Aerospace contractors in Wichita also sponsor foreign nationals for technical leadership positions tied to specialized engineering programs.
What visa types are most common for technical leads in Kansas?
The H-1B is the most common visa for technical lead roles in Kansas, as these positions typically qualify as specialty occupations requiring at least a bachelor's degree in a relevant field like computer science or engineering. Candidates with extraordinary ability in their discipline may qualify for an O-1A. Canadians and Mexicans in qualifying engineering or computer roles may also be eligible for TN status, which does not require a lottery.
Which Kansas cities have the most technical lead visa sponsorship jobs?
Overland Park and the broader Johnson County area generate the highest volume of technical lead sponsorship activity in Kansas, driven by Garmin, Oracle Health, and a concentration of IT employers in the Kansas City metro. Wichita is the second major hub, particularly for aerospace and systems engineering technical leads. Lawrence, home to the University of Kansas, produces a smaller but notable pipeline of tech talent that some employers recruit locally.

Are there any Kansas-specific considerations for technical leads seeking visa sponsorship?
Kansas employers sponsoring H-1B technical leads must pay Department of Labor prevailing wages for the specific role and geographic area, which are set at wage levels reflecting local market rates rather than national averages. Wichita and the Kansas City metro have different prevailing wage benchmarks. Kansas's aerospace sector often requires security clearance eligibility, which can limit sponsorship for some foreign national candidates, particularly for roles tied to defense contracts with Spirit AeroSystems or Boeing's Wichita operations.
What is the prevailing wage for sponsored technical lead jobs in Kansas?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
